Introduction:

In the current fast-paced world, the standard 9-5 working arrangements not applies to many households. Using the rise of dual-income households and non-traditional work hours, the interest in 24-hour daycare solutions happens to be steadily increasing. 24-hour daycare facilities provide parents the flexibility they need to stabilize work and family responsibilities, and provide a safe and nurturing environment for kids 24 / 7.

Great things about 24-Hour Daycare Near Me - Find The Best Daycares Near You:

Among crucial advantages of 24-hour daycare may be the flexibility it gives working moms and dads. Numerous moms and dads work changes that stretch beyond standard daycare hours, which makes it difficult to get childcare that fits their particular schedule. 24-hour daycare facilities resolve this problem by providing treatment during nights, vacations, and also instantaneously. This permits moms and dads to exert effort without fretting about finding someone to watch kids during non-traditional hours.

Another good thing about 24-hour daycare may be the satisfaction it provides to parents. Realizing that kids are now being taken care of by trained specialists in a safe and safe environment can relieve the tension and guilt that often is sold with leaving kids in daycare. Moms and dads can target their work understanding that kids come in good arms, that may cause increased productivity and work satisfaction.

In addition, 24-hour daycare facilities provides a feeling of community and assistance for families. Parents whom work non-traditional hours usually find it difficult to get a hold of childcare choices that satisfy their needs, causing thoughts of separation and anxiety. 24-hour daycare facilities can offer a feeling of that belong and camaraderie among moms and dads facing similar challenges, generating a support community that will help households thrive.

Challenges of 24-Hour Daycare:

While 24-hour daycare centers offer many benefits, in addition they incorporate their own group of difficulties. One of the primary challenges is staffing. Finding qualified and reliable childcare providers who are happy to work non-traditional hours are tough, ultimately causing high turnover rates and potential staffing shortages. This can impact the grade of attention offered to children and create instability for people counting on 24-hour daycare solutions.

Another challenge of 24-hour daycare may be the cost. Offering attention 24 / 7 needs extra staffing and resources, which can drive up the cost of services. This is often a barrier for low-income people which is almost certainly not able to afford 24-hour daycare, leaving these with minimal choices for childcare during non-traditional hours.

Regulation and Oversight:

So that you can make sure the security and well-being of young ones in 24-hour daycare facilities, regulation and supervision are necessary. State and neighborhood governments put requirements for certification and accreditation of daycare centers, including the ones that run twenty-four hours a day. These standards cover a wide range of areas, including staff-to-child ratios, health and safety demands, and staff instruction and qualifications.

In addition to federal government laws, numerous 24-hour daycare centers decide to seek accreditation from national companies like the National Association for the knowledge of small children (NAEYC) or even the National Association for Family childcare (NAFCC). Accreditation shows a consignment to top-notch attention and will assist parents feel confident in their chosen childcare provider.
